TANGIPAHOA PARISH, La. (WGNO) — The Tangipahoa Parish Sheriff’s Office is currently on the search for a repeat escaped inmate.
Deputies were alerted at 10 p.m. on Thursday, May 22, that 19-year-old Tra’Von Johnson had escaped after receiving a call form the public asking if Johnson was still at the facility.
Johnson was in custody awaiting trial for his alleged role in a 2020 home invasion that left a man dead and the victim’s child injured.
An immediate headcount was conducted and through investigation, they determined he had left the facility around 4:30 p.m.
TPSO jail staff reported another inmate helped lift Johnson over the perimeter will and that he was the only one to escape.
Victims, family members and associates of Johnson have been alerted. Partnering law enforcement agencies are also assisting in the search.
Johnson is described as having brown eyes, black hair, stands at 5’5″ and weighs 120 lbs. He is from Tickfaw and has ties to the Hammond area.
Johnson was also one of four inmates who escaped the same facility during May of 2024.
